FG has increased gas to power price to $2.42/MMBTU.

 

NewsOnline Nigeria reports that the Nigerian Midstream and Downstream Petroleum Regulatory Authority (NMDPRA) has changed the price of gas to power from $2.18MMBTU to $2.42MMBTU.

This Nigeria news platform understands that the Authority Chief Executive, Engr. Farouk Ahmed, made the disclosure in a document titled: “Announcement of the Year 2024 Domestic Based Price (DBR) and Applicable Wholesale of Natural Gas for Strategic Sectors.”
